V. New Business

a. Discussion of Proposed 3-Phase ARPA Process

i. Phase I – Identify Categories (8/1 – 8/31)

Discussion on the focus of what this committee should be doing vs the FAC.  Our charge is surrounding identifying opportunities.  Our short-term focus through August would be to identify categories for potential dissemination of ARPA funds.  Ellie mentioned that the Rec Club is looking for funding for the tennis courts and baseball field at the fairgrounds.  We would want to create categories of ideas to date to be able to survey the community.  

ii. Phase II – Survey on Category Preferences (9/1 – 10/15)

Once the categories are created we would survey the town to get input on how they would spend $100 imaginary dollars towards these categories, not on specific ideas, but rather the categories.  

iii. Phase III – Report on Survey Results (10/15 – 11/30)

Take survey related data to bring category preferences to the Selectboard/Planning Commission/FAC.  Motion passed to adopt this three phase approach.  

b. Work on Categorizing Ideas if Approved

Potential categories: Emergency preparedness, community sustainability and enhancement, housing and residential needs, movement and mobilization

c. Brainstorm on How to Gather More Ideas

Want to include information surrounding gathering ideas on categories/projects the town could utilize the ARPA funds for.  One way is talking to people (potentially canvassing people at the polls or providing them informational letter with email address).  Jaime to create an email address to gather ideas from community.  This could be posted on Front Porch Forum and Facebook, pending approval from Zon on use of email address.  Potentially share information at the Guilford Fair.  Informational piece to be created to describe ARPA goals.  Informational letter to contain announcement of what process is, explanation of what ARPA dollars can be spent on, and an explanation of why we are gathering information/data, providing link for feedback and next steps for the committee.  Next meeting to focus on categorization of submitted ideas (note: these are not applications, just ideas – the charge of this committee does not include taking/approving applications).
